@font-face
版本:CSS2
兼容性:IE4+
语法:@font-face
{
font-family
:
name
src
:
url
(
url
)
sRules
}
取值:name
:
字体名称。任何可能的
font-family
属性的值
url
(
url
)
:
使用绝对或相对
url
地址指定OpenType字体文件
sRules
:
样式表定义
说明:设置嵌入HTML文档的字体。此规则无默认值。
此规则使你能够在网页上使用客户端本地系统上可能没有的字体。
url
地址必须指向
OpenType
字体文件(.eot或.ote)。
html5外链式引入不了字体html5外链式引入不了字体,css中导入外部字体不生效的原因是什么?
今忱
转载
关注
0点赞·1542人阅读
css中可以使用@font-face引入外部字体,使用@font-face规则,网页设计师再也不必使用的"web-safe"的字体之一。有时使用@font-face规则引入外部字体不生效是什么原因?
出现不起作用的时候应该检查如下几个方面:
第一:路径是否正确,可以打开控制台,查看网络请求中是否有对应字体文件的请求 *** 作
第二:IE9 + 虽然支持font-face但是只能 引用embedded 系列的字体 必须在src :url (xxxx) 加上format('embedded-opentype')
第三:如果是在canvas中使用 引入的字体,出现了不生效,或者首次加载不生效的时候。在body标签canvas画布之前加一个
设置html的字体家族为引入的字体就好。这样做的目的是告诉浏览器,这个字体被启用了
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)